Willington, Thomas, of co. Warwick, pleb. Queen's Coll., matric. 17 Nov., 1581, aged 17; B.A. from Trinity Coll. 12 Nov., 1584, M.A. 6 July, 1587; one of these names baptised at Kingsbury, co. Warwick, 2 Feb., 1566 (son of Waldyve, of Hurley); died 1652.

Willington, Waldive, gent. Trinity Coll., matric. 9 Dec., 1653; student of Middle Temple 1654 (as son and heir of Waldive, of Hurley Hall, co. Warwick, esq.); baptised at Kingsbury 3 March, 1633; died 2 Nov., 1677. See Foster's Inns of Court Reg.

Willis, Browne, s. Thomas, of Blandford St. Mary, Dorset, gent. Christ Church, matric. 23 March, 1699-1700, aged 17, M.A. by diploma 23 Aug., 1720, D.C.L. by diploma 10 April, 1749; born at Blandford 14 Sept., 1682, educated at Westminster school; student of Inner Temple 1700, M.P. Buckingham (Dec.) 1705-8, F.S.A. 1718; died at Whaddon Hall, Bucks, 5 Feb., 1760, buried in Fenny Stratford chapel; brother of John 1708. See Rawl. i. 246, and xix. 347; Al. West. 205; Foster's Inns of Court Reg.; & Hearne, i. 117.

Willis, Caleb, of Devon, gent. Christ Church, matric. 22 April, 1586, aged 18, B.A. 10 Dec., 1589, student 1586-99, M.A. 9 June, 1592; the first professor of rhetoric in Gresham college 1598; will at Oxford, proved 23 March, 1599. See Al. West. 58.

Willis, Francis, scholar St. John's Coll. 1557, B.A. 16 Feb., 1562-3, M.A. 16 Feb., 1565-6, B. and D.D. 17 July, 1587, president of his college 1577-90, vice-chancellor 1587; vicar of Embley, Northants. 1569-72; rector of Kingston Bagpuze 1581, and vicar of Cumnor, (both) Berks, 1579, canon of Bristol 1576, dean of Worcester 1587, and vicar of Cropthorne, co. Worcester, 1589; died 29 Oct., 1596. See Lansdowne MS. 982, f. 147; Gutch, i. 538; & Foster's Index Eccl. [5],

Willis, Francis, s. Hugh, of Thame, Oxon, cler. New Coll., matric. 11 Nov., 1681, aged 17, fellow 1681, B.A. 1685, M.A. 1689, B.Med, 1691, D.Med. 1694; admon. at Oxford 23 Nov., 1702; brother of William 1675. See Ath. iv. 558.

Willis, Henry, (Wyllys), B.A. from Corpus Christi Coll. 9 May, 1509, M.A. 30 May, 1514, B.D. 24 May, 1530.

Willis, Henry, s. Nic., of Cucklington, Somerset, pleb. pp. St. Alban Hall, matric. 1 July, 1664, aged 17, B.A. 1668; M.A. from New Inn Hall 1680.

Willis, Hugh, "serv." s. John, of Winchester, Hants, pleb. St. Alban Hall, matric. 2 June, 1647, aged 22; B.C.L. from New Coll. 29 Nov., 1656; vicar of Thame, Oxon, 1665; father of Francis, See Burrows, 531; & Foster's Index Eccl.

Willis, James, s. Franc., of St. Martins, co. Worcester, pleb. Exeter Coll., matric. 2 June, 1711, aged 19; perhaps rector of Driby, co. Lincoln, 1718. See Foster's Index Eccl. [10],

Willis, John, of Oxon, gent. New Coll., matric. 23 Jan., 1606-7, aged 20, B.A. 29 April, 1611, fellow, M.A. 20 Jan., 1614-15; (s. John) perhaps rector of Ovington, Hants, 1618. See Foster's Index Eccl.

Willis, John, subscribed 3 June, 1614; an original scholar of Wadham Coll. 1613-20, B.A. 25 Feb., 1616-17, M.A. 7 July, 1620; incorporated at Cambridge 1626, vicar of Hockley 1619, and of Ingateston, Essex, 1630, until ejected for nonconformity 1662; perhaps father of John 1649. See Gardiner, 15; Foster's Index Eccl.; & Calamy, ii. 204.

Willis, John, s. Thomas, of London, gent. Gloucester Hall, matric. 18 June, 1630, aged 16; perhaps B.A. from Wadham Coll. 2 Dec., 1637.

Willis, John, sacerd fil. Wadham Coll., matric. 20 Feb., 1648-9, though B.A. 17 Oct., 1648, fellow 1649, M.A. 27 July, 1650; rector of West Horndon 1658, and of Ingrave, (both) Essex, 1658. See Burrows, 563; & Foster's Index Eccl. [15],

Willis, John, s. John, of Oxford (city), gent. Christ Church, matric. entry 1 April, 1680, aged 14, B.A. 1683; M.A. from New Inn Hall 1687; vicar of Powerstock, Dorset, 1690. See Foster's Index Eccl.

Willis, John, 1694-5. See Wills.

Willis, John, s. Henr., of Blandford St. Mary, Dorset, cler. Wadham Coll., matric. 4 Nov., 1697, aged 18; brother of Robert 1693, and of William 1705.

Willis, John, s. Fran., of Worcester (city), p.p. Christ Church, matric. 8 July, 1701, aged 16, B.A. 1705.

Willis, John, s. J., of Hinxey, Berks, gent. St. Mary Hall, matric. 17 Dec., 1703, aged 27; B.C.L. from Oriel Coll. 1710.

Willis, John, s. Thomas, of Bletchley, Bucks, gent. Christ Church, matric. 17 July, 1708, aged 18; brother of Browne. [20],

Willis, Jonathan, sacerd fil. Exeter Coll., matric. 13 Feb., 1648-9. See Wills, next page.

Willis, Joseph, s. Tho., of Dunton, Bucks, S.T.D. Pembroke Coll., matric. 22 Jan., 1682-3, aged 17; rector of Horsendon, Bucks, 1697; brother of Thomas 1676. See Foster's Index Eccl.

Willis, Richard (Wullus), chaplain, B.A. supd. 25 March, 1511.

Willis, Richard, of co. Gloucester, pleb. Corpus Christi Coll., matric. 10 Nov., 1621, aged 18.

Willis, Richard, B.A. from All Souls' Coll. 5 March, 1627-8; M.A. from Brasenose Coll. 3 July, 1632; rector of Loughton, Essex, 1638. See Foster's Index Eccl. [25],

Willis, Richard, s. William, of Bewdley, co. Worcester, pleb. Wadham Coll., matric. 5 Dec., 1684, aged 18; fellow All Souls' Coll., B.A. 1688, M.A. by diploma 15 March, 1694-5, D.D. Lambeth 27 March, 1695; chaplain to the army in Flanders, sub-tutor to William, duke of Gloucester, canon of Westminster 1695, canon and dean of Lincoln 1701, rector of Clayworth, Notts, 1703-6, and vicar of Wirksworth, co. Derby, 1705-14, bishop of Gloucester 1715-21, of Salisbury 1721-3, and of Winchester 1723, lord almoner and clerk of the closet, until his death 10 Aug., 1734, monument in Winchester cathedral. See Rawl. i. 153, v. 145; Hearne, i. 69; & Foster's Index Eccl.

Willes, Robert, B.A. 23 Jan., 1544-5.

Willis, Robert, of co. Worcester, pleb. Magdalen Hall, matric. entry under date 15 April, 1580, aged 19; B.A. from Brasenose Coll. 29 Oct., 1583; fellow Oriel Coll. 1584.

Willis, Robert, s. Hen., of Blandford St. Mary, Dorset, cler. Balliol Coll., matric. 13 March, 1692-3, aged 17, B.A. 1696, M.A. 1699; rector of Witchampton, Dorset, 1699-1727; brother of William 1705, and John 1697. See Foster's Index Ecclesiasticus.

Willis, Thomas, of St. John's Coll. in and before 1566, "aedituus" 1581. [30],

Willis, Thomas, of (Fenny Compton), co. Warwick, pleb. St. John's Coll., matric. 11 June, 1602, aged 19 (as Willes), B.A. 2 June, 1606, M.A. 21 June, 1609 (as Willes), incorporated at Cambridge 1619, schoolmaster at Isleworth, Middlesex, about 50 years; son of Richard, and father of Thomas 1646. See Ath. iii. 406.

Willis, Thomas, B.A. from St. Alban Hall, supd. 21 June, 1622. See O.H.S. xii. 414.

Willis, Thomas, of Berks, pleb. Christ Church, matric. 14 Dec., 1621, aged 16, B.A. 22 June, 1625.
